The cheapest way to get from Tea Gardens to Bathurst is to bus via Hornsby which costs $25 - $40 and takes 9h 29m.
The fastest way to get from Tea Gardens to Bathurst is to drive which takes 4h 45m and costs $65 - $100.
No, there is no direct bus from Tea Gardens to Bathurst station. However, there are services departing from Myall St At Maxwell St and arriving at Bathurst Station, Coach Stop via Broadmeadow Station, Graham Rd and Strathfield Station, Everton Rd.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 48m.
The distance between Tea Gardens and Bathurst is 453 km. The road distance is 374.1 km.
The best way to get from Tea Gardens to Bathurst without a car is to bus and train which takes 8h 27m and costs $35 - $320.
It takes approximately 8h 27m to get from Tea Gardens to Bathurst, including transfers.
Tea Gardens to Bathurst bus services, operated by Busways, depart from Myall St At Maxwell St station.
Tea Gardens to Bathurst bus services, operated by Busways, arrive at Broadmeadow Station, Graham Rd.
Yes, the driving distance between Tea Gardens to Bathurst is 374 km. It takes approximately 4h 45m to drive from Tea Gardens to Bathurst.
